Vincent Cellini was paid $185,026.54 in total compensation as Mechanical Technician at Ontario Power Generation in 2025, 85% above Ontario's $100,000.00 Sunshine List threshold.

Vincent Cellini has appeared on the Ontario Sunshine List 3 times since 2023, earning $529K in combined disclosed pay — an average of $176,292.00 a year, up 21% over that span.

That is 9% above the average disclosed pay of $170,201.67 across 10,346 listed Ontario Power Generation employees.

Salary data is published annually by the Ontario government under the Public Sector Salary Disclosure Act. Only employees earning $100,000+ are disclosed.
